2020年终总结——走在代码公益的路上

Posted 微wx笑

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了2020年终总结——走在代码公益的路上相关的知识,希望对你有一定的参考价值。

从2012年加入 CSDN 博客,已经过去了8个年头,有收获也有感慨;目前总排名24,虽然排名已经很靠前了,也是输出了很多内容,但不像一些人输出的都是比较系统性的内容,所以带给平台及自己的回报都不大,几次博客之星的评选都没有获取名次;So,如果你愿意输出,那么我建议你最好是写系列性的系统性的内容,像我输出那么多,也帮助了不少人,但是~~~~。

今年一年基本很少在CSDN发布文章了,自从有了自己的个人网站,更多的是折腾自己的网站,也是想写点什么就写点什么,不需要受大网站条条框框的限制,香港主机,也不那么容易被河蟹……。另一方面,也是没有什么高质量的内容要推而广之,大家看不看也没什么损失。这一年也没怎么接触技术相关的东西,基本是在吃老本了,更多的时间是在学习投资,在被割韮菜的路上。直到近期参与了一个公益项目,才对技术接触的多了一点,觉得还是有必要分享一下。

说到公益项目,开源项目算不算公益项目呢?我觉得也应该算吧!不过我参与的不是开源项目,而是码上公益的项目;码上公益,一个通过写代码做公益平台,你值得加入!

这里对项目中使用工具、技术做一个介绍。

主要工具:

语雀:项目需求相关文档管理

Github:版本控制

蓝湖:设计图标注

飞书:主要使用他们的表格功能,语雀在表格处理上做的差很多

xiaopiu:原型设计

VS Code:我用它来做为前端开发工具

服务器运维

操作系统:centos最高版本(有8就用8,没有8用7)

web server:springboot自带tomcat、nginx

运维监控:阿里云云监控

安全:centos自带防火墙

服务器登录方式:使用密钥登录,并禁用密码登录

数据库:同台服务器上自建mysql5.7

对象存储:阿里云OSS

CDN:七牛云

全盘自动备份:基于OSS的自动快照策略(一日一备,保留一日)

数据备份:通过shell脚本每日备份压缩,同步到阿里云oss

技术架构

数据库:MySQL

后端开发语言:JAVA

核心框架:Spring Boot 2.x + jpa

安全框架:shiro

视图框架:前后端分离,不涉及这个,如果需要,选用thymeleaf做页面。freemarker做模板

持久层框架:hibernate

定时器:springtask

数据库连接池:Hirika

日志管理:slf4j

前台前端框架:nuxt

后台前端框架:vue-element-admin,这里涉及的是 node.js,vue.js,element ui

小结

2020年充满了挑战,疫情将生活的常态打破,但很快我们又恢复了常态的生活。每一次挑战来了,我们感觉这是有史以来最大的挑战了,但未来的挑战,远远超出我们的想象,远比我们经历过的多,但我们已经适应,已经习惯,时刻准备着。

那么,对于这样一个技术栈,你有什么想说的呢?对于写代码做公益你有什么想法呢?

 

以上是关于2020年终总结——走在代码公益的路上的主要内容,如果未能解决你的问题,请参考以下文章

ATFX公益ATFX捐赠防疫物资,传递暖暖真情

ATFX公益ATFX捐赠防疫物资,传递暖暖真情

DBA公益 | 魏桥彩虹之家,小书包承载大梦想

高考免费数据库查询,不断更新中,高考志愿填报公益系列

中韩人寿获颁中国公益节“2020企业社会责任行业典范奖”

百度刘超2020:天津美院学生参加百度刘超HCI公益课